Output 26f66301a4b91ab9d0a669dbcebfee8b2c85cd6584c7c117fe61f8c2d83652d0:3

value
71040
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71cd9440b670c3831f804ec045d43cc259951fe3c77aabcb7441fe1c034e4f60
address
bc1pw8xegs9kwrpcx8uqfmqyt4pucfve28lrcaa2hjm5g8lpcq6wfasqzyfdrc
transaction
26f66301a4b91ab9d0a669dbcebfee8b2c85cd6584c7c117fe61f8c2d83652d0
spent
true